Replacing RV Ceiling Fan with East Seventeen Fan
Published 11/17/2020 >
Question:
My current fan has a switch on the wall. Can I just swap it out to this fan with the same wiring?
asked by: Kirby
Expert Reply:
You might be able to wire up the East Seventeen fan, part # 344410TSDC36BNOKCY, without any additional wiring but it depends on your current fan.
If the old one has the reverse switch on the wall switch then yes the wiring is all there. However, a lot of RV fans have the reverse switch on the fan and not on the wall. The East Seventeen fan does have the reverse on the wall. If yours is on the fan then you'll need to add an additional wire for that function from the fan to the wall switch.
